Alejandra Peñaloza is an illustrator based in Berlin. Her work celebrates the magic of nature, the charm of everyday life, and the quiet beauty of small moments. Her work is rich with thoughtful detail, characterised by immersive atmospheres, balanced colour palettes, and dynamic compositions. While she primarily works digitally, her illustrations retain the warmth and texture of acrylic paint-a nod to her roots in traditional media. She immerses herself in each project to gain insight into the behaviours, movements, and stories that characterise her subjects. She translates these observations into vibrant, dynamic images, capturing the essence of each subject both in its natural setting and in dreamlike scenarios. Her approach balances accurate representation with subtle surrealism, highlighting the wonder of the natural world and everyday life. She gathers firsthand references when possible to ensure authenticity and depth in her work. This ongoing exploration deepens her understanding of the energy of her subjects and keeps her connected to the natural world. Alejandra holds a BA in Graphic Design from Universidad Iberoamericana, Mexico City, and an MA in Fine Art from Kingston University, London. |
